TMJ Headache Symptoms If your headache is due to TMD, your symptoms might include: Pain in one or more parts of your head or face Pain that gets worse when you move your jaw or chew hard food Trouble opening your mouth all the way A clicking, popping, or grating sound when you move your jaw Soreness in one or both sides of your jaw A change in how your upper and lower teeth fit together Dizziness Ringing in your ears Sensitive teeth (not due to another reason) TMJ headache locations Its common to feel the most pain in these areas: Jaw Cheeks Behind your eyes Temples (the sides of your forehead) You could also ache around your ears and in your shoulders, neck, and upper back
